Delhi School Admissions Process: Dates to Remember
The Delhi Nursery admission forms are to be released by December 04, 2025. Here are the complete admission dates for Delhi school admissions as announced by the DoE:
|
Admission Stage |
Important Date |
|
Start Date to Fill Application Forms |
04-12-2025 |
|
Last Date to Submit Application Forms |
27-12-2025 |
|
First List of Selected Candidates |
23-01-2026 |
|
Second List and Waitlisted Candidates |
09-02-2026 |
|
Subsequent List, if Available |
05-03-2026 |
|
Closing of Admissions |
19-03-2026 |
|
Types of Forms Available |
Online & Offline |

Age Criteria for Nursery, KG, and Class 1 Admissions in Delhi
The new age criteria, announced recently by the DoE, state that a child must be a minimum of 3 years old by March 31st of the year in which admission is sought. While the age criteria make considerable changes to the foundational framework (breaking KG to LKG and UKG and implementing a 6+ years age criterion for admission to Class 1), the DoE has made it clear that the transition will happen gradually, with the new structure starting in 2026-27 and that existing students will not be affected.
Here is a closer look at the age criteria announced by DoE for the academic year 2026-27:
|
Class |
Age Criteria |
Born Between |
|
Nursery |
3+ years as of 31 March 2026 |
1 Apr 2022 – 31 Mar 2023 |
|
KG |
4+ years as of 31 March 2026 |
1 Apr 2021 – 31 Mar 2022 |
|
Class I |
5+ years as of 31 March 2026 |
1 Apr 2020 – 31 Mar 2021 |
Note: While the age criteria for nursery admissions in Delhi are strictly enforced, some schools allow a 30-day relaxation on upper and lower age limits. In case of concerns, it is always a good idea to reach out to the school directly.

What is the Age Criteria for Admission to Higher Classes?
For admission to higher classes, the guideline is straightforward: each class typically requires the child to be one year older than the previous. For example, since the minimum age for admission to Class 1 is 6 years, the age requirement for admission to Class 2 is 7 years, that for Class 3 is 8 years and so on.
Here is a clear look at the age criteria for higher classes in Delhi schools, as has been followed according to DoE guidelines:
|
Class |
Minimum Age |
Maximum Age |
|
Class 2 |
7 |
8 |
|
Class 3 |
8 |
9 |
|
Class 4 |
9 |
10 |
|
Class 5 |
10 |
11 |
|
Class 6 |
11 |
12 |
|
Class 7 |
12 |
13 |
|
Class 8 |
13 |
14 |
|
Class 9 |
14 |
15 |
|
Class 10 |
15 |
16 |
|
Class 11 |
16 |
17 |
|
Class 12 |
17 |
18 |
Please Note: Some schools offer flexibility on the upper age limit for higher classes but are firm about the lower age limit for younger classes. For students who have repeated a year or failed, some schools may offer a relaxation in the upper age limit to accommodate their admission. If you have concerns or need clarification, it’s best to reach out directly to the school for accurate information.

Understanding the Delhi School Admission Point System
Delhi school admissions follow a point system to select students for admission. These points are awarded by allotting students points as per a list of criteria. These criteria, and the allotment of points to different criteria, can be different in different schools.
The different criteria that schools consider when allotting points are as follows.
- Distance of the students’ residence from the school
- Sibling quota
- Child of transferred defence/ paramilitary employee
- Parents being alumni of the school
For example, here is how a school might reward points as per the distance of the student’s residence from the school.
- For distances up to 6 Km – 40 Points
- 6 to 8 Km – 30 Points
- More than 8 Km – 20 Points
Remember, it completely depends on the school you are applying to.

Documents Required for School Admission in Delhi
Here is a list of the important documents that you might need:
- Passport-size pictures of the child and parents
- A print-out of the filled application form
- A family photo consisting of the parents and the child
- Proof of residence, any two of the following should be kept ready:
- A ration Card issued in any one of the parent's name, containing the child’s name on it
- Domicile Certificate of either the child or any of the parents
- Voter ID of any of the parents
- Electricity/ Water/ Phone Bill issued to any of the parents
- Aadhar/ UID Card of any of the parents
- Birth Certificate
- Tuition fee receipt of applicant’s sibling, in case you are applying via the sibling quota
- Proof regarding parents being alumni of the school, for those applying via the alumni criteria

Non-Plan Admission in Delhi Schools
The Delhi government had designed the scheme to cater to Non-plan admission to students who had dropped out of school for some reason or other.
For example, students who have had to change schools due to relocation to Delhi, or who want to transfer from an unrecognized school can avail admission through the non-plan admission scheme.
Basically, the ultimate objective of the non-plan admission system is to ensure that students do not have to suffer by taking a gap year. Instead, these students can continue their studies from where they left off.
Non-Plan admission in Delhi schools usually begins around May. The eligibility criteria can vary from school to school, depending on the class that one is seeking admission to, and can be looked up on the school sites.
Getting in through non-plan admission can be quite competitive as students need to sit for an exam and score good marks to secure their admission.
